What are remote influence jobs?

Remote influence jobs are positions where professionals use digital tools and communication channels to persuade, guide, or impact others’ decisions, behaviors, or opinions from a remote location. These roles often exist in fields such as marketing, sales, social media, public relations, and online education. Remote influence professionals may work as digital marketers, social media strategists, virtual sales representatives, or online community managers. Their main goal is to achieve organizational objectives by effectively engaging with target audiences through online platforms. These jobs require strong communication, strategic thinking, and digital literacy sk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Influencer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Influencer, you need expertise in content creation, digital marketing, and personal branding, often demonstrated by a strong online presence and knowledge of social media algorithms. Familiarity with platforms like Instagram, TikTok, YouTube, analytics tools, and sometimes influencer marketing platforms is crucial. Creativity, authenticity, and excellent communication skills help build trust and engage diverse audiences. These skills are important because they drive audience growth, brand partnerships, and sustained influence in a competitive digital landscape.

How does a Remote Influencer typically collaborate with brands and marketing teams while working offsite?

As a Remote Influencer, you'll frequently coordinate with brands and marketing teams through virtual meetings, email, and collaboration platforms to align on campaign goals and deliverables. You'll need to manage communications efficiently, adhere to deadlines, and provide regular updates on content creation and engagement metrics. Building strong relationships remotely requires clear, proactive communication and flexibility to adapt your content to different brand voices. Many influencers also participate in brainstorming sessions and feedback cycles to ensure their work resonates with target audiences.
